Lazy Lasagna

Lasagna is always a family favorite, but it can be very time consuming to make it just right. Well, Megan is making all of our lives easier with this super easy Lazy Lasagna recipe that has all of the same flavors, but doesn’t include all of the steps of making the traditional dish. To start, you’ll need one pound of ground beef, half of a cup of chopped onion, one 24-28 ounce jar of spaghetti sauce, a fourth of a cup of Parmesan cheese, half a teaspoon of Italian seasoning, a fourth of a teaspoon of garlic powder, one 25 ounce bag of frozen cheese ravioli and two cups of shredded mozzarella cheese.

Start by preheating your oven to 350º. In a skillet, cook the ground beef and onion, then drain off the excess fat. Add the sauce, Parmesan cheese, Italian seasoning and garlic powder. Stir and simmer for 10 minutes.

Spread half of a cup of the spaghetti sauce into the bottom of a 9 x 13-inch baking dish. Arrange one third of the frozen ravioli in a single layer. Top with half of the remaining sauce and sprinkle with some mozzarella cheese. Repeat two more layers and sprinkle with remaining shredded mozzarella cheese. Bake for 30 to 40 minutes, until ravioli are cooked through and the edges are bubbling, then pair it with some delicious garlic bread and a salad for a balanced meal.
